The 2026 Screen Actors Guild (SAG) Awards recently unfolded, transforming the red carpet into a spectacular showcase of cutting-edge fashion. Occurring on the eve of the fall ready-to-wear presentations in Paris, the event highlighted a distinct trend: the enduring elegance of black and white ensembles, mirroring the prevailing palette seen on the runways. A multitude of stars, including Kirsten Dunst, Jenna Ortega, and Britt Lower, graced the occasion in outfits sourced directly from New York's recent fashion shows. Demi Moore, among others, captivated onlookers with selections from the spring couture collections, notably her striking Schiaparelli gown, which featured a unique alligator motif at the front and a voluminous, frothy design at the back. This year's SAG Awards underscored a seamless transition of high fashion from the catwalk to celebrity glamour.

The convergence of the SAG Awards with the global fashion calendar provided a unique platform for designers and actors alike. Kirsten Dunst's appearance in a Khaite design exemplified the immediate impact of ready-to-wear, with her look drawn directly from the fall 2026 collection. Similarly, Jenna Ortega's choice of Christian Cowan's fall 2026 ready-to-wear piece further underscored the event's role in catapulting runway trends into mainstream visibility. These instances demonstrate a rapid adoption cycle, where designs shown just weeks prior in New York found their way onto one of Hollywood's most watched stages.

Beyond ready-to-wear, the allure of haute couture also made a significant statement. Demi Moore's choice of a spring couture piece from Schiaparelli was a testament to the dramatic and artistic possibilities within high fashion. Her dress, with its unconventional silhouette and intricate details, became a major talking point, exemplifying how celebrities leverage such events to push fashion boundaries. Other notable appearances, such as Kristen Bell and Hannah Einbinder, also embraced designs that featured striking back or side detailing, a design element that invariably creates a lasting visual impact.

The sartorial selections at the 2026 SAG Awards were not limited to a single aesthetic but rather celebrated a diverse range of designer visions. From Monique Lhuillier's elegant ready-to-wear to Christian Cowan's bold statements and Willy Chavarria's distinctive menswear, the red carpet was a dynamic exhibition of current and upcoming fashion trends. Male actors, including Sam Nivola in Dior Men and Law Roach in Public School, also showcased sophisticated and contemporary menswear designs, emphasizing the event's broad fashion appeal.
